How to Make Airline Chicken

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ious dish:

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). This temperature ensures even cooking and a beautifully browned exterior on your airline chicken.

Prepare Marinade: In a bowl, combine olive oil, lemon juice, garlic powder, dried oregano, salt, and pepper. Whisk together until fully blended.

Marinate Chicken: Place the boneless skinless chicken breasts in a resealable bag or shallow dish. Pour the marinade over them and seal or cover. Let it marinate for at least 30 minutes in the refrigerator for optimal flavor.

Bake Chicken: Remove the marinated chicken from the fridge and place it in a greased baking dish. Bake for about 25-30 minutes or until cooked through (internal temperature should reach 165°F/75°C).

Prepare Sauce (Optional): While the chicken bakes, mix soy sauce with a dash of honey in a small saucepan over low heat until warmed through. This will be a perfect drizzle over your finished dish.

Serve With Style: Transfer baked airline chicken to plates and drizzle with prepared sauce for an elegant presentation that enhances both flavor and aesthetics.

Overcooking the chicken

Overcooking airline chicken is a common mistake that leads to dry and tough meat. Always use a meat thermometer to check for doneness; the internal temperature should reach 165°F (75°C). To avoid overcooking, consider roasting at a higher temperature around 425°F (220°C) for about 25-30 minutes. Alternatively, you can grill or pan-sear the chicken for a juicier result. Keep an eye on cooking times and remove the chicken from heat as soon as it reaches the desired temperature to maintain its tenderness.

Skipping resting time

Not allowing airline chicken to rest after cooking is another frequent error that can ruin your meal. Resting allows juices to redistribute within the meat, preventing them from escaping when you slice into it. Aim for a resting period of about 10-15 minutes after removing it from heat. Cover the chicken loosely with foil during this time to retain warmth while letting it settle. This simple step ensures your airline chicken remains moist and flavorful when served.

What is Airline Chicken?

Airline Chicken refers to a specific cut of chicken breast that includes part of the wing attached. This cut is known for its tenderness and rich flavor due to the presence of dark meat. It is often served in upscale restaurants and is appreciated for its aesthetic appeal when plated.

How do I cook Airline Chicken?

To cook Airline Chicken effectively, preheat your oven to 375°F. Season the chicken breasts with salt, pepper, and any preferred spices. Sear them skin-side down in a hot skillet until golden brown, then transfer to the oven to finish cooking for about 20-25 minutes or until they reach an internal temperature of 165°F.

Can I marinate Airline Chicken?

Yes! Marinating Airline Chicken can enhance its flavor significantly. Consider using a mixture of olive oil, lemon juice, garlic, and herbs as a marinade. Allow the chicken to soak in these flavors for at least one hour or overnight in the refrigerator for best results before cooking.

What are some popular sauces for Airline Chicken?

Airline Chicken pairs well with various sauces such as creamy mushroom sauce or tangy lemon butter sauce. You can also try serving it with a balsamic reduction or chimichurri for an added layer of flavor that complements its richness beautifully.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 34 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 1/4 cup extra virgin ol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ons freshly squeezed l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 2 tablespoons low-sodium soy sauce (for optional glaze)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. In a bowl, whisk together olive oil, lemon juice, garlic powder, oregano, salt, and pepper.
  3. Marinate the chicken in a resealable bag for at least 30 minutes.
  4. Place the marinated chicken in a greased baking dish and bake for 25-30 minutes until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(75°C).
  5. Optional: Prepare sauce by warming soy sauce with honey over low heat.
  6. Serve hot with a drizzle of sauce.
